Serena Cartoon Paper Outlines Why They Think She Is Not A Feminist Hero [Video]

Apparently, we haven't yet moved on from the Serena Williams discussion. Here's the Herald Sun with more to say on the matter.

What do you do when the world is watching you dig a hole deeper and deeper?

You keep digging, apparently.

In case you’re unsure of the Serena Williams versus the Herald Sun showdown, it started with the Herald Sun publishing a racist cartoon by Mark Knight.

The backlash soon followed, but rather than take the criticism on board, the paper soon doubled down on their front page.

Hey Australia, if you’re wondering why the rest of the world thinks you have a serious racism problem…

Anyway, around the same time the paper was doubling down and defending Knight, Andrew Bolt delivered this message.

Published on the Herald Sun’s website with the headline “Why Serena Williams is no feminist hero”, I guess we’re going to hear what Bolt has to say.

It comes with this write-up:

Serena Williams claims to be a victim of sexism after her amazing tantrum at the US Open women’s final. Others claim she’s a victim of racism. Let me show you the clips that expose this fraud – and show why identity politics is the refuge of scoundrels. My editorial from The Bolt Report.

Yes, the tennis superstar who has inspired millions of people, especially young, black women, is a fraud.

Serena didn’t cover herself in glory with her behaviour, clearly, but I’m really not sure old white Ozzie men should be considered authorities on racism and sexism.
